Comprehending the Technology: Transponders and Immobilizers
To comprehend why a car key needs reprogramming, one must first comprehend the relationship in between the key and the lorry’s Engine Control Unit (ECU). Since the late 1990s, most makers have geared up vehicles with immobilizer systems.

At the heart of this system is the transponder chip, situated inside the head of the key or the body of the key fob. When the Key Fob Programming is inserted into the ignition or the “Start” button is pressed, the car sends out an electronic burst to the key. The transponder chip reacts by sending out a special alphanumeric code back to the ECU. If the code matches the series saved in the automobile’s memory, the immobilizer is shut off, and the engine starts. If the codes do not match, the fuel pump and ignition system stay handicapped.

Reprogramming is not a routine maintenance job; it is a corrective or preventative measure. There are a number of circumstances where a lorry owner might need this service:
Lost or Stolen Keys: To prevent a lost key from being utilized by an unapproved individual, the car’s memory should be wiped of previous codes and new codes must be set for the replacement keys.Key Malfunction: Electronic elements inside a key can fail due to physical damage, water exposure, or electro-magnetic interference.Purchasing a Used Car: For security factors, owners of newly acquired pre-owned vehicles typically choose to reprogram their secrets to ensure no previous owners have functional access.Dead Batteries (In some models): While many modern-day fobs maintain their memory after a battery modification, some older European designs might “lose their sync” if the battery stays dead for an extended period.Ignition Barrel Replacement: If the ignition system is replaced, the digital handshake between the new part and the existing secrets should be integrated.The Reprogramming Process
While some lorries enable “On-Board Programming” (a DIY series of turning the key and pressing buttons), most modern cars and trucks require specialized diagnostic devices.
Step-by-Step OverviewDiagnostic Connection: A specialist connects a programming tool to the lorry’s On-Board Diagnostics (OBD-II) port, normally found under the dashboard.Identification: The software identifies the automobile’s VIN, make, design, and the particular security algorithm utilized.Clearing Old Data: In cases of lost secrets, the specialist clears the existing “known” keys from the ECU’s memory.Signal Synchronizing: The brand-new key is presented to the system. The programming tool advises the ECU to accept the brand-new transponder code.Evaluating: The professional validates that the remote functions (lock/unlock) work which the transponder effectively bypasses the immobilizer to start the engine.Comparison: Professional Services vs. DIY

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can I program a car key myself?
It depends on the automobile. Some older Ford, Toyota, and GM designs enable “on-board programming” if you have two working secrets. However, for most vehicles made after 2010, specialized software application linked to the OBD-II port is required.
2. How long does the reprogramming procedure take?
Generally, the process takes in between 15 and 45 minutes. This timeframe can increase if the vehicle’s security system needs a “timed out” waiting duration (typical in some security procedures to avoid theft).
3. Can I buy a cheap key online and have it programmed?
Yes, however with caution. Many “cheap” secrets discovered on auction sites lack the appropriate transponder frequency or are used secrets that have been “locked” to another Car Key Programming Cost‘s VIN. It is generally more secure to buy the key directly from the locksmith to guarantee compatibility.
4. Will reprogramming my key fix a remote that won’t open the doors?
If the battery is fresh and the buttons are physically personnel, then yes, reprogramming can re-sync the remote to the car’s receiver. However, if the circuit board is damaged, a new key will be necessary.
5. Does the car requirement to be present for the service?
In nearly all cases, yes. The programming tool should communicate with the car’s ECU. You can not merely bring a key to a shop and have it set without the car being physically available to the specialist.
